The biggest announcement from Google Cloud Next 2022 from a DevOps perspective is the general availability of the Software Delivery Shield security solution. Check out the blog post about it here

https://cloud.google.com/blog/products/devops-sre/introducing-software-delivery-shield-from-google-cloud

and let us know what you think of this suite of tools designed as an end-to-end solution to protect software from security attacks along the entire software supply chain.

Supply chain attacks on open source software packages increased by 650% in 2021.
The biggest and most well known example of this in the wild is the Log4J vulnerability.
Components  within Software Delivery System such as Artifact Registry and Container Registry would have  prevented such a vulnerability.
Almost every organization and software team in one form or another depend on opensource software.
As we get smarter so do the bad guy’s, the Software Delivery Shield along with proper backups are a step in the right direction moving forward for any development team.
